    Looking at the pictures of the rackets breaking apart and at their shape, I think it is more likely that the Rackets are made from wood. A little research shows that Ash is a fairly common wood that is used to make wooden rackets, it has a shear Strength of 10 MPa.
    Secondly, the racket acts as a lever. In this case I would treat it as a Cantilever. I don't have the expertise to count pixels and compare, but for sake of argument lets say the racket is 72 cm, this falls in regulation size and judging from the screen shots the racket is about 1/2 the size of Mario, it also makes for easier math. The "sweet spot" for a tennis racket can vary, how ever, if we assume that it is 1/4 of the way from the top of the racket and that the top of Mario's hand is 1/4 from the bottom that would mean we have a cantilever with a length of 360mm.
    To find the force exerted on the racket at the top of Mario's hand we use (Force*lengthFromOrgin)/CrossSection = (65N*360mm)/740mm^2 = 31.622N/mm^2 = 31.622 MPa
    Meaning the 65N the ball generates is about 3 times the force needed to break a racket made of Ash wood. Of course an actual racket would be made of laminated wood, for which I could not find a shear strength of and would vary greatly anyway depending on the adhesives used.
